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2091 60 9211 51334 137866
63 13877
63 13877
55613096 581677 159
All about undefined
Interested in learning more?
63 13877
55613096 581677 159
See more
367 51496076334
8177228709 067709 505
See more
09582565 26775657284
64078 97669032086 690
See more